Mary wants to do a cheesecake. She needs 4 1/2 cups of sweet cream. She knows that 1
cup = 8 ounces How many ounces does she need?

Answer:

36 ounces

Step-by-step explanation:

If 1 cup equals 8 ounces, you would multiply 4 1/2 by 8. 8 x 4 is 32 (ounces), and half of 8 is 4, so 4 ounces. You would then add 32 and 4 together to get your answer. Hope this helps!!
